[xserver PULL master] modesetting HW cursor patches

Michael Thayer michael.thayer at oracle.com
Sat Jan 28 09:29:56 UTC 2017


Hello Adam and Keith,

For some reason you got left off CC on that message.  No idea why, you 
are still there in the copy in my "sent" folder...

Regards
Michael

27.01.2017 17:51, Michael Thayer wrote:
> Hello Adam and Keith,
>
> These patches have been hanging around for a while (since October in
> fact), and never made it into the tree.  They were reviewed by Hans, who
> suggested that I try preparing a rebased branch with the patches and
> send a pull request.  So finally done that.
>
> Thanks
> Michael
>
> The following changes since commit
> 7617a0a180a2cd3427a8ffa9534152df6a8fecbf:
>
>   dri2: refine dri2_probe_driver_name (v2) (2017-01-25 15:13:33 -0500)
>
> are available in the git repository at:
>
>   https://github.com/michael-thayer/xserver.git
>
> for you to fetch changes up to 4163091129eed352166a59c2681edc2da313e436:
>
>   modesetting: allow switching from software to hardware cursors (v5).
> (2017-01-27 16:09:08 +0100)
>
> ----------------------------------------------------------------
> Michael Thayer (3):
>       xfree86: Immediately handle failure to set HW cursor, v5
>       modesetting: Immediately handle failure to set HW cursor, v5
>       modesetting: allow switching from software to hardware cursors (v5).
>
>  hw/xfree86/drivers/modesetting/drmmode_display.c | 45
> ++++++++++--------------
>  hw/xfree86/drivers/modesetting/drmmode_display.h |  2 --
>  hw/xfree86/modes/xf86Crtc.h                      |  4 ++-
>  hw/xfree86/modes/xf86Cursors.c                   | 40
> +++++++++++++++------
>  hw/xfree86/ramdac/xf86Cursor.h                   | 16 +++++++++
>  hw/xfree86/ramdac/xf86HWCurs.c                   |  8 ++---
>  6 files changed, 71 insertions(+), 44 deletions(-)
>

-- 
Michael Thayer | VirtualBox engineer
ORACLE Deutschland B.V. & Co. KG | Werkstr. 24 | D-71384 Weinstadt

ORACLE Deutschland B.V. & Co. KG
Hauptverwaltung: Riesstraße 25, D-80992 München
Registergericht: Amtsgericht München, HRA 95603

Komplementärin: ORACLE Deutschland Verwaltung B.V.
Hertogswetering 163/167, 3543 AS Utrecht, Niederlande Handelsregister 
der Handelskammer Midden-Nederland, Nr. 30143697
Geschäftsführer: Alexander van der Ven, Jan Schultheiss, Val Maher


More information about the xorg-devel mailing list